Based on the historical population data provided for ZIP code 75078 in Prosper, Texas, the area has experienced significant growth and urbanization over the past decade. The population has more than quadrupled from 8,718 in 2010 to 38,653 in 2022, while the population density has increased from 280.86 people per square mile to 1,245.26 people per square mile during the same period.
This ZIP code, which spans an area of 31.04 square miles, has transitioned from a rural to a suburban classification due to its rapidly increasing population density. In 2010, with a population density of 280.86 people per square mile, the area would have been classified as rural, characterized by larger living spaces, fewer public services, and a community-oriented lifestyle centered around local schools and small businesses.
However, by 2022, the population density had surpassed the 1,000 people per square mile threshold, placing it firmly in the suburban category. The rapid population growth and increasing density suggest that Prosper has been experiencing significant urban development activity over the past decade. This development likely includes the construction of new housing, infrastructure, and amenities to accommodate the growing population. The estimated number of housing units corresponding to the 2022 population, based on the national average household size of 2.61, is approximately 14,810 units.
